What is a butcher packer?

Career: Butcher Packer

Butcher Packers are workers responsible for preparing, cutting, and packaging meat products in retail stores, butcher shops, or processing plants. They handle raw meat, trim and cut it according to specifications, and ensure that it is properly packaged for sale or distribution. Their duties often include weighing, labeling, and inspecting meat for quality and safety. Butcher Packers must follow strict hygiene and food safety standards to prevent contamination. The role requires attention to detail and knowledge of different types of meats and cuts.
